The Batman Family #14

Oct 1977 · DC · 0.60 USD
“Old Super-Heroines Never Die-- They Just Fade Away!”

In "Old Super-Heroines Never Die—They Just Fade Away!", Batgirl faces a terrifying mystery when Batwoman disintegrates before her eyes, leaving her to discover she’s been exposed to a deadly virus that will soon consume her too. With time running out, Batgirl and Robin must race to uncover the source of the illness before it’s too late. Written by Bob Rozakis and illustrated by Don Heck, with inks by Bob Wiacek, colors by Jerry Serpe, and letters by Ben Oda, this 1977 issue features a striking cover by Jim Aparo.
